With plans to see SP Energy Networks (SPEN), part of the ScottishPower Group, look to invest over 5bn in transmission projects across our transmission network in central and southern Scotland by 2030. The HVDC team will play a key role in supporting SPEN to work at pace to deliver the transmission network that is required to support ambitions Scottish and UK Government 2030 targets.

SPEN are currently recruiting a Principal Engineer to join the SP Transmission HVDC Projects team to undertake the Engineering Design function for primary plant in Eastern Green Link (EGL) Projects. The position holder will undertake Primary Plant design activities on EPC HVDC Contracts as well as provide Primary Plant expert advice across the HVDC Projects portfolio.

This role involves working with Engineering experts from SPT's, Project Joint Venture Partner, the Contractor to support the delivery of HVDC interconnector projects, and ensuring innovative designs for Primary Plant equipment that meet specified functional technical requirements. SP Energy Networks is part of the Iberdrola Group, one of the world's largest integrated utility companies and a world leader in wind energy. We keep electricity flowing to homes and businesses through Central and Southern Scotland, North Wales and in the North West of England. We operate over 4000km of cables and lines that make-up the transmission network - connecting infrastructure like wind farms into the electricity system. It's a role that puts us right at the heart of Scotland's ambition to be Net Zero by 2044. And we're taking it very seriously. We're investing >5.5 billion into our transmission network, directly supporting the rapid growth needed in renewable energy.
